Read this article to find the latest information about Failed To Connect To Github.Com Port 443 Timed Out, all carefully summarized by us.
Failed to Connect to Github.com Port 443 Timed Out: A Comprehensive Guide
Imagine embarking on a coding journey, only to be met with the dreaded “Failed to connect to github.com port 443 timed out” error message. This can be particularly frustrating, especially when you’re eager to access invaluable code repositories or collaborate with fellow developers. Understanding the underlying causes and devising effective solutions can help you overcome this hurdle and continue your coding seamlessly.
Identifying the Problem: What is Port 443 Timeout?
A port timeout error typically occurs when the client (your computer) fails to establish a connection with the server (GitHub.com in this case) within a specified time frame. Port 443 is the standard port used for HTTPS (Hypertext Transfer Protocol Secure), the secure and encrypted version of the HTTP protocol. When this connection fails, you’ll encounter the “port 443 timed out” error.
Causes and Solutions: Unraveling the Error
Various factors can contribute to a port 443 timeout error, including but not limited to:
-
Temporary Network Issues: Interruptions in your internet connection or GitHub’s servers can disrupt the connection.
-
Firewall and Antivirus Blocks: Firewalls and antivirus software may mistakenly block the connection to GitHub.
-
Incorrect DNS Settings: A misconfigured Domain Name System (DNS) setup can prevent your computer from translating GitHub’s domain name (github.com) to its corresponding IP address.
-
Outdated Software: Running outdated operating systems, browsers, or software can lead to communication issues with modern servers.
To address these potential causes, consider the following solutions:
-
Check Your Network Connection: Ensure your internet connection is stable and that you have a strong signal.
-
Whitelist GitHub in Firewall and Antivirus: Allow GitHub in your firewall and antivirus software to avoid blocking the connection.
-
Verify DNS Settings: Use public DNS servers like Google Public DNS (8.8.8.8 and 8.8.4.4) or Cloudflare DNS (1.1.1.1 and 1.0.0.1) for reliable DNS resolution.
-
Update Software: Install the latest updates for your operating system, browser, and software to ensure compatibility with GitHub’s servers.
Tips and Expert Advice: Embracing Best Practices
Seasoned developers recommend adopting certain practices to minimize port 443 timeout errors:
-
Use a VPN: A virtual private network (VPN) can bypass potential network restrictions and provide a more stable connection.
-
Try Alternative Git Servers: If GitHub’s connection remains unstable, consider using alternative Git hosting platforms like GitLab or Bitbucket.
-
Check GitHub’s Status Page: Monitor GitHub’s status page for updates on any outages or maintenance work that may affect connectivity.
-
Use GitHub CLI: The GitHub Command Line Interface (CLI) tool provides advanced functionality and may offer more control over the connection process.
Use the Console to Identify Error Messages
Observing the error messages displayed in the console can help identify the underlying cause of the timeout error. In a terminal or command window:
-
Run the command:
git fetch origin
-
Analyze the output for specific error messages that could indicate problems with network connectivity, firewall settings, or DNS resolution.
Frequently Asked Questions
Q: Why does the “port 443 timed out” error occur?
A: This error can stem from various factors, such as network issues, firewall blocks, incorrect DNS settings, or outdated software.
Q: What steps can I take to resolve the error?
A: Check your network connection, whitelist GitHub in security software, verify DNS settings, update software, and use a VPN if necessary.
Q: How can I use the GitHub CLI to troubleshoot the issue?
A: Run the command git fetch origin
and observe the error messages in the console. This can provide specific insights into the underlying cause.
Q: Is there an alternative to using GitHub?
A: Yes, you can explore other Git hosting platforms like GitLab or Bitbucket if GitHub’s connection remains unstable.
Conclusion
Overcoming the “Failed to connect to github.com port 443 timed out” error is achievable by understanding the underlying causes and implementing effective solutions. By implementing the tips and recommendations outlined in this article, you can effectively diagnose and resolve the issue, ensuring a smoother and more efficient coding experience.
Is this article informative and relevant to the topic you were curious about?
Image: programmerah.com
Failed To Connect To Github.Com Port 443 Timed Out has been read by you on our site. Thank you for your visit, and we hope this article is beneficial for you.